Perovskite/Si Absorption Calculator

The absorption in a simplified perovskite/silicon tandem stack is calculated using the RayFlare Python package. The stack has been simplified to consist of only three layers: an MgF2 anti-reflection coating, a perovskite absorber, and a silicon absorber. You can also choose whether to include a silver (Ag) back reflector. Each of the interfaces (ARC/perovskite front surface, perovskite/silicon interface, and the rear silicon surface) can be textured with pyramids with an opening angle of 54°. The absorption in each layer, and reflection and transmission losses, are calculated as a function of wavelength which are integrated with the AM1.5G spectrum to calculate the maximum possible currents in each layer.
